Exactly. In nature, evolution "distills" proven traits and behaviors across generations via selection pressure and inheritance—recursive improvement without reinventing the wheel each time. AI distillation mirrors that: a smaller model absorbs the large model's refined outputs for fast, efficient learning. Smart efficiency, biological or silicon.

Not exactly copy-paste. Distillation trains a smaller model on a larger model's outputs to mimic smart behavior quickly and cheaply, like a student learning from solved examples instead of deriving everything alone. OpenAI flags it legally because their terms often restrict using outputs for rival training, turning it into a competitive boundary test in court—even if it's industry-standard.
